Chicago Bears vs. Dallas Cowboys

  • Pick: Bears +9.5

The Cowboys should win this game, but the Bears are a better team than people think they are, and they proved that on Monday night against the Patriots. The Bears rank 17th in net yards per play, and their defense has taken huge steps forward in recent weeks. I think this spread is too big.

Pittsburgh Steelers vs. Philadelphia Eagles

  • Pick: Eagles -10

The battle of Pennsylvania is a lopsided matchup this week. The Eagles rank third in net yards per play heading into this week, while the Steelers rank dead last. Philadelphia's offensive and defensive line should dominant Pittsburgh's.

New York Giants vs. Seattle Seahawks

  • Pick: Seahawks -3

I'm fading the Giants for the foreseeable future. They have a 6-1 record, but they rank 27th in net yards per play. Meanwhile, the Seahawks offense has been one of the best in the NFL, averaging 6.2 yards per play. I'll back the Seahawks to end New York's winning streak.
